Template:Color are topics that a site is about. (For example, Google.com should be tagged as "search engine" and CNN.com as "news".) Making sure that a site is listed under relevant tags is important so that it will show up in appropriate lists.
- Q: How do I add tags?
- A: While on the AboutUs page about the website click the "Edit" pencil to the right of the tags section header. (If a page doesn't have any yet you go straight to the box to add them.) Then add the tags that you want separated by commas and click "Add".
- Q: How do I remove tags?
- A: Click the "edit" pencil to the right of the tags section header, check the boxes of the tags you want to remove, and click "Remove Tags".
